CVE-2022-0547
Published: 18 March 2022
OpenVPN 2.1 until v2.4.12 and v2.5.6 may enable authentication bypass in external authentication plug-ins when more than one of them makes use of deferred authentication replies, which allows an external user to be granted access with only partially correct credentials.
Priority
CVSS 3 base score: 9.8
